How Does Tank Size Affect Fish Maintenance Needs?

Tank size affects fish maintenance needs significantly. Larger tanks provide more water volume, which leads to better water quality. Good water quality helps maintain a stable environment for fish. In contrast, smaller tanks can become polluted quickly. This pollution requires more frequent cleaning and water changes.

Larger tanks can support more fish. This reduces stress by allowing fish to establish territories and avoid confrontations. Smaller tanks may lead to overcrowding. Overcrowding increases stress and disease risk among fish.

Additionally, larger tanks offer more stable temperature and pH levels. Fish experience less stress in stable environments. In small tanks, temperature and pH can fluctuate rapidly. These fluctuations can harm fish health.

Filtration systems also have a higher capacity in larger tanks. This means better waste removal and less maintenance work for the owner. Owners of small tanks may need to use more frequent filter changes and landscape adjustments to manage waste.

In summary, larger tanks simplify maintenance, support fish health, and provide a more stable environment. Smaller tanks require more care and attention, which increases overall maintenance needs. Fish owners should consider tank size carefully to ensure their fish thrive.

What Are the Key Water Parameters That Must Be Maintained?

The key water parameters that must be maintained include temperature, pH, hardness, alkalinity, and ammonia levels.

  1. Temperature
  2. pH Level
  3. Hardness
  4. Alkalinity
  5. Ammonia Levels

Understanding these parameters is essential for maintaining a healthy aquatic environment. Each parameter plays a critical role in the well-being of fish and aquatic plants.

  1. Temperature:
    Temperature refers to the degree of heat present in the water. It significantly affects fish metabolism and behavior. Most fish species thrive in specific temperature ranges. For example, tropical fish typically prefer warmer waters between 75°F and 80°F (24°C to 27°C). The American Fisheries Society emphasizes that maintaining the ideal temperature is crucial for fish health and breeding. Sudden temperature changes can cause stress and lead to health issues.

  2. pH Level:
    pH Level measures the acidity or alkalinity of water. It is expressed on a scale of 0 to 14, with 7 being neutral. Most freshwater fish prefer a pH between 6.5 and 7.5. The Aquarium Conservation Association indicates that improper pH levels can lead to fish stress, affecting their immune systems. For example, a study by Pearse and Wroblewski (2018) demonstrated that certain species, like the Betta fish, are particularly sensitive to pH fluctuations.

  3. Hardness:
    Hardness refers to the concentration of dissolved minerals, particularly calcium and magnesium ions in water. Water hardness is categorized as soft, moderately hard, or hard. Different fish require varying hardness levels, with cichlids generally preferring harder water while many tetras thrive in softer conditions. The World Aquaculture Society notes that proper hardness supports overall fish health and helps prevent stress-related diseases.

  4. Alkalinity:
    Alkalinity is the capacity of water to neutralize acid, primarily due to bicarbonates. It stabilizes pH levels and prevents sudden changes. The ideal alkalinity for most aquariums ranges from 3 to 10 dKH (degrees of carbonate hardness). The Fisheries and Aquatic Ecosystems Journal indicates that balanced alkalinity protects fish from pH swings that can cause stress and harm.

  5. Ammonia Levels:
    Ammonia Levels indicate the concentration of toxic ammonia in the water, which can arise from fish waste, uneaten food, and decaying plants. Safe levels should be at 0 parts per million (ppm). High ammonia levels can lead to ammonia poisoning, which is fatal to fish. The United States Environmental Protection Agency (EPA) establishes stringent guidelines for ammonia levels to ensure aquatic life health. Regular testing and filtration can help maintain safe ammonia levels in aquariums.

How Frequently Should Fish Be Fed for Optimal Health?

To ensure optimal health, fish should be fed once or twice a day. This frequency helps maintain their energy levels and promotes healthy growth. Overfeeding can lead to water quality issues and health problems. Therefore, provide only as much food as the fish can consume in a few minutes. This approach prevents excess food from decaying in the tank. Adjust feeding habits based on the fish species, age, and size, as different species have varying dietary needs. Monitor the fish’s behavior and health regularly to determine if adjustments are needed. Following these guidelines supports the overall well-being of the fish.

How Can New Fish Owners Successfully Set Up Their First Aquarium?

New fish owners can successfully set up their first aquarium by selecting the right tank size, ensuring proper filtration, cycling the aquarium, maintaining water conditions, and choosing suitable fish species.

  1. Selecting the right tank size: A larger tank (at least 20 gallons) is often easier to maintain than a smaller one. Larger tanks provide stable water parameters and more swimming space for fish. The size also determines the number and type of fish you can keep.

  2. Ensuring proper filtration: A good filter keeps the water clean and removes harmful toxins. Filters come in various types, including hang-on-back, canister, and sponge filters. Each type has its advantages, but all must match the tank’s size and fish load to effectively maintain water quality.

  3. Cycling the aquarium: Cycling refers to the process of establishing beneficial bacteria in the tank that convert harmful ammonia into less harmful substances. This usually takes 4 to 6 weeks. One popular method is the fishless cycle, which uses ammonia instead of fish to feed the bacteria, ensuring that the tank is safe before adding fish.

  4. Maintaining water conditions: Regular testing of water parameters, such as pH, ammonia, nitrite, and nitrate levels, is crucial. Ideal pH levels typically range between 6.5 to 7.5 for most freshwater fish. Using a water conditioner can remove chlorine and chloramines from tap water, making it safe for fish.

  5. Choosing suitable fish species: New owners should select hardy fish that can adapt to varying conditions. Species like guppies, platies, and bettas are generally recommended for beginners. Each species has specific care requirements, so it is essential to research them before making a selection.

By following these key points, new fish owners can create a healthy and thriving aquarium environment.
